你查询的IP:[60.63.45.156]  地理位置:中国–上海–上海电信/东方有线

最新查询123.160.32.96 218.192.95.52 218.37.205.195 210.76.230.189 117.121.184.86 122.115.64.243 121.255.205.44 121.192.169.153 123.180.252.199 60.63.45.156 202.38.152.110 116.213.128.153 120.192.39.224 162.105.11.84 125.214.96.245 119.112.21.161 202.148.96.63 210.22.134.233 121.79.128.195 60.253.128.62 210.21.133.102 116.214.64.162 121.52.224.192 119.3.206.228 203.223.41.11 202.164.188.22 61.4.176.77 60.208.96.99 202.122.128.25 202.43.144.141 202.38.158.140